
Ensure the provision of adequate changing & toilet facilities at all University sports grounds, providing a hygienic and safe environment
Lead Officer: Angus Gueterbock, Sport Officer
What is the issue about?
Toilet and Changing provisions have been overlooked at many of the university sports grounds.
Whilst there are toilets within the STV, these can be up to 10 minutes away from the pitch. This can cause significant disruption to player experience (missing up to 20-30 minutes of their offer, just to go to the loo). The only other option for a student is to do their business by the side of the field.
The changing facilities are also located within the STV. There is less impact here as these are typically only used before and after a session. However, at many university sports grounds there is little-to-no shelter to protect participants in the event of severe weather or injury.
Whilst this does affect students taking part in their competitive offers. This has a bigger effect on the recreational offers. For students who are less “sporty”, the prospect of having to go for a hike to access basic amenities will likely put many off turning up.
What are we asking the University to do?
We are asking the university to evaluate its toilet and changing provision at all university sports grounds. Where there is not an adequate provision, we are asking the university to invest in these facilities.
What will success look like?
Improved provision across university sports grounds.
